Program managers of NUHM, Odisha shall learn best practices during the 4-day Management Development Program from experts of  PGIMER Chandigarh4-day Management Development Program kick started at PGIMER, Chandigarh
“Thecurrent Management Development Program for Public Health Managers of NUHM Odisha will help in mutual learning of innovations in urban areas towardshealthier communities. This program is an excellent initaive to create apositive impact and Governement of Haryana is happy to host and learn from theState of Odisha.”saidDr. R. S Poonia, DGHS Haryana, chief guest of theoccasion during the inaugural ceremony of 4-Day Management Development Program,tailoredfor public health managers of the National Urban Health Mission (NUHM) Odishabeing organised by Postgraduate Institute of Medical Education and Research(PGIMER) Chandigarh. This program aims to equip 36Public HealthManagers fromOdisha with a comprehensive understanding of urban health and related concepts,empowering them to apply these insights effectively in their respective worksettings.Thisprogram for Urban Health official is first in the country, and second in the series is being organised by theDepartment of Community Medicine and the School of Public Health at StateInstitute of Health and Family welfare, Haryana. This innovative program hasbeen requested by NHM, Odisha and is being hosted as a part of the renownedInternational Public Health Management Development Program, a flagship programof Ministry of External Affairs  whichhastrained more than 1,100 participants from over 85 countries  said Dr Sonu Goel, Program Director andProfessor, Department of Community Medicine and School of Public Health,PGIMER, Chandigarh,ThisNUHM-specific program represents a pioneering effort, focusing on criticalareas such as gap analysis, GIS-based vulnerability mapping, Monitoring andEvaluation, Strategic and Operational Planning, report writing, and leadershipskills enhancement.The program will be taught byexperts, including Prof. RavindraKhaiwal, Prof. Madhu Gupta, and Prof. Sonu Goel and Dr.Kritika Upadhyay fromDepartment of Community Medicine and School of Public Health, PGIMER,Chandigarh.Asan integral part of the program, participants will embark on field visits,including a model Urban Primary Health Center (UPHC) in Kurukshetra. This one-dayvisit will showcase the delivery of primary healthcare services, the provisionof accessible and comprehensive healthcare in urban areas, and the utilizationof innovative healthcare technologies such as e-Sanjeevani teleconsultation,MERA ASPATAAL, electronic health records via e-UPCHAAR, and the Public-PrivatePartnership (PPP) model. Additionally, participants will attend an outreachcamp to witness community engagement efforts by Haryana State. Besides, a panelon sharing of good practices in implementing NUHM by the states of Haryana,Chandigarh and Punjab will be conducted on last day.The program’s teachingpedagogy will encompass diverse learning techniques, including case studies,panel discussions, role-playing, video presentations, and gamification.Upon programcompletion, participants will formulate an Action Planfor their respectivedistricts based on the knowledge gained during the program.
